The Venezuela Space Robotics market is a niche but growing sector within the country`s aerospace industry. With a focus on developing robotic technologies for space exploration, satellite deployment, and other space missions, Venezuelan companies are making strides in this field. Key players in the market include government agencies such as the Bolivarian Agency for Space Activities (ABAE) and private companies like VeneSpace. Investment in research and development is increasing, driven by the country`s ambitions to expand its presence in space technology. Collaboration with international partners and participation in space projects are also helping to propel the growth of the Venezuela Space Robotics market, positioning the country as a player in the global space industry.

In the Venezuela Space Robotics Market, several challenges are faced due to the economic and political instability in the country. The lack of funding and investment in research and development hinders the growth and innovation in the space robotics sector. Additionally, limited access to advanced technology and expertise, as well as the brain drain of skilled professionals, further impede the development of space robotics capabilities in Venezuela. The country`s unreliable infrastructure and energy supply also pose challenges in establishing and maintaining sophisticated space robotics operations. Overall, the Venezuela Space Robotics Market struggles with systemic issues that hinder its ability to compete on a global scale and realize its full potential in the space technology industry.

Government policies in Venezuela related to the space robotics market are currently limited due to the country`s economic and political challenges. The Venezuelan government has shown some interest in developing the space sector but has not implemented specific policies targeting space robotics. The lack of clear regulations, investment incentives, and infrastructure development hinders the growth of the space robotics market in Venezuela. Political instability and international sanctions also contribute to the uncertain environment for space-related industries. Without a clear government strategy and support, the potential for growth and innovation in the Venezuela space robotics market remains constrained.
